Abstract
We demonstrate selective pump focusing for highly isolated single-mode lasers in microdisk and microring cavities, and achieve lasing action from a microdisk cavity underneath a scattering medium. The spatial profile of the pumping light evolves by an iterative feedback process and is optimized to maximize the field overlap with a selected cavity mode. The high order of mode selectivity and high resolving power are obtained in a multimode cavity in the presence of significant modal overlaps. As a result of the adaptive optical pumping, we successfully achieve the efficient energy transfer to a microdisk underneath a random scattering medium and observe lasing action through the scattering medium. We believe that our selective pumping procedure will pave the way for the development of low-threshold, single-mode nanolasers embedded in various materials.© 2018 American Chemical Society
